Nigerian filmmaker and actress Funke Akindele has responded to a fan who asked her when she is buying a Lamborghini.

For the past few weeks, Lamborghini has become a trending topic on social media following Burna Boy and Sophia Egbueje’s Lamborghini brouhaha and Mercy Eke buying a Lamborghini.

Kemi Filani reported last week that the internet went wild after Big Brother Naija winner, Mercy Eke announced the arrival of her Lamborghini.

While still reeling from the shock, an audio recording surfaced online of socialite Sophia Egbueje narrating her sexual relationship with Burna Boy and his promise to buy her a Lamborghini, which he didn’t fulfill. Luckily for her, she was able to get it herself.

In a Snapchat interaction with her fans, a fan had inquired when Funke was buying her own Lamborghini.

“When are you buying a Lamborghini?” the fan asked.

Funke, responding to him, noted how people on social media always use everything to play and see things as jokes. The movie star jokingly vowed to block the fan as she further questioned why they are fond of using everything to trend.

“Everything is always funny to you people Abi? I will block you. It is everything you guys are using to trend?”.

Last year, Funke had opened up on the hard times she experienced before rising to stardom. She shared a video of herself being active on the set of her highest-grossing billion-dollar movie, A Trībe Called Judah, as she counted herself as a testimony of believing in herself, saying she faced different challenges but learned to stand tall and encourage others because of them.

Funke is currently the Queen of the box office as her latest Cinema movie, Everybody Loves Jenifa became the highest-grossing film of all time in West Africa with 1.6 billion. The filmmaker undoubtedly beat her previous record for A Tr!be Called Judah, which grossed over N1.4 billion.
